@ -88,6 +88,15 @@ STATIC NORETURN mp_obj_t pyb_bootloader(void) {
}
STATIC M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_0(pyb_bootloader_obj, pyb_bootloader);
/// \function hard_reset()
/// Resets the pyboard in a manner similar to pushing the external RESET
/// button.
STATIC mp_obj_t pyb_hard_reset(void) {
NVIC_SystemReset();
return mp_const_none;
}
STATIC M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_0(pyb_hard_reset_obj, pyb_hard_reset);

nlr_buf_t nlr;
bool ret;
int ret;
uint32_t start = HAL_GetTick();
if (nlr_push(&nlr) == 0) {
usb_vcp_set_interrupt_char(VCP_CHAR_CTRL_C); // allow ctrl-C to interrupt us
mp_call_function_0(module_fun);
usb_vcp_set_interrupt_char(VCP_CHAR_NONE); // disable interrupt
nlr_pop();
ret = true;
ret = 1;
} else {
// uncaught exception
// FIXME it could be that an interrupt happens just before we disable it here
usb_vcp_set_interrupt_char(VCP_CHAR_NONE); // disable interrupt
// check for SystemExit
mp_obj_t exc = (mp_obj_t)nlr.ret_val;
if (mp_obj_is_subclass_fast(mp_obj_get_type(exc), &mp_type_SystemExit)) {
// None is an exit value of 0; an int is its value; anything else is 1
mp_obj_t exit_val = mp_obj_exception_get_value(exc);
mp_int_t val = 0;
if (exit_val != mp_const_none && !mp_obj_get_int_maybe(exit_val, &val)) {
val = 1;
}
return PYEXEC_FORCED_EXIT | (val & 255);
}
mp_obj_print_exception((mp_obj_t)nlr.ret_val);
ret = false;
ret = 0;
}
